Liebig Puerto Rico 1910s Vista del Pueblo de Cayey Postcard Information: Background: Very rare color postcard showing a town view of Cayey, Puerto Rico in the 1900-10s. We see native huts, bridge and river. Type of card: divided back Size: Standard postcard size (approximately 3.5 x 5.5 inches) Publisher: F. Liebig, San Juan, P. R. Number: 190 Condition: vg, wob, st Postally Used: Mailed October 1914 from San Juan, PR Payment & shipping: Payments by PayPal or Moneybookers.
